Software Developer - Johannesburg - African Ambition

    African Ambition
    African Ambition Johannesburg

    2 days ago

    Default job background
    Description

    Job Title: Software Developer

    We are seeking a highly motivated and innovative software developer to join our team. The ideal candidate will display enthusiastic leadership, technical expertise, and the ability to manage projects and prioritize deadlines.

    Objectives of this Role:

    • BUILD CLIENT-FOCUSED, NEXT-GENERATION WEB APPLICATIONS
    • SUPPORT FULL-STACK WEB DEVELOPMENT BY APPLYING AGILE METHODOLOGIES FOR SPRINT PLANNING, DESIGN SESSIONS, DEVELOPMENT, TESTING, AND DEPLOYMENT
    • OVERSEE DIVERSE, COHESIVE TEAMS FOR HIGH-QUALITY DELIVERY TO CLIENTS
    • DESIGN, DEVELOP, TEST, AND ENHANCE SOFTWARE SOLUTIONS

    Responsibilities:

    • PARTICIPATE IN THE FULL SOFTWARE DEVELOPMENT LIFECYCLE, INCLUDING ANALYSIS, DESIGN, TEST, AND DELIVERY
    • DEVELOP WEB APPLICATIONS USING A VARIETY OF LANGUAGES AND TECHNOLOGIES
    • FACILITATE DESIGN AND ARCHITECTURE BRAINSTORMS
    • PARTICIPATE IN CODE REVIEWS
    • COLLABORATE WITH TEAM MEMBERS TO DEFINE AND IMPLEMENT SOLUTIONS

    Required Skills and Qualifications:

    • EXPERIENCE IN DEVELOPING SOFTWARE WITH HTML5 AND CSS3 WEB STANDARDS
    • FAMILIARITY WITH ANGULAR, POLYMER, CLOSURE LIBRARY, OR BACKBONE
    • UNDERSTANDING OF FULL-STACK WEB, INCLUDING PROTOCOLS AND WEB SERVER OPTIMIZATION STANDARDS
    • ONE OR MORE YEARS OF EXPERIENCE IN SOFTWARE DEVELOPMENT
    • STRONG PROFICIENCY WITH JAVASCRIPT
    • DEEP KNOWLEDGE OF PROGRAMMING LANGUAGES SUCH AS JAVA, C/C++, PYTHON, AND GO


  • Hlabahlosile Johannesburg

    You will design, develop, and maintain software applications across various platforms. · Write efficient and well-structured code that is easy to understand and maintain. · Collaborate with cross-functional teams, including Product, Design, and Quality Assurance (QA), to define s ...


  • Brownsjewellers Johannesburg

    Browns, a family-owned jeweller established in 1934, is renowned for crafting exquisite diamond jewellery in South Africa. · Job Description · Software Developer · We are seeking an experienced Software Developer to join our dynamic team in Craighall, Johannesburg. · Why Us? · At ...


  • Brownsjewellers Johannesburg

    About Browns · We are a family-owned jeweller that crafts the finest diamond jewellery in South Africa. Founded in 1934, we have become an iconic brand with a rich heritage by focusing on classic, timeless and sophisticated designs. · Our quintessentially South African designs ar ...


  • Datafin IT Recruitment Johannesburg

    Job Description: · An innovative software company is seeking a remote mid-level full-stack developer to collaborate within a cross-functional team, contributing to all phases of the software development life cycle. · The successful candidate will be responsible for developing dyn ...


  • Ingenious personnel Johannesburg

    **Software Development Team Member Wanted** · We are seeking a skilled developer to join our team and contribute to the design, development, and deployment of cutting-edge software solutions. · The ideal candidate will have a strong background in .Net Core, C#, Angular, and MS SQ ...


  • Network Contracting Johannesburg

    Key Skills & Experience: · Backend Development: Proficient in Java 8+ (Streams, Lambda), Spring Boot frameworks. · Cloud & DevOps: Experienced in Azure DevOps, AWS, Docker, AKS, Kibana, Dynatrace platforms. · Integration & Security: Skilled in REST/SOAP APIs, SSL encryption, and ...


  • People Source Johannesburg

    Our team is seeking a skilled professional to collaborate with global leaders in the financial technology sector, working on core banking systems and IT infrastructure projects. This remote role requires individuals based in South Africa. · ...


  • Be Different Recruitment Johannesburg

    Software Development Manager · A leading cash management company seeks a Software Development Manager to develop technology strategy and lead a team of developers. The manager will be accountable for the delivery of complex solutions. · Duties & Responsibilities · Bachelor's degr ...


  • Indsafri Johannesburg

    Job Title: Software Developer Manager · We are seeking a seasoned Developer Manager to lead and mentor a team of software engineers, drive technical excellence, and collaborate with cross-functional teams to deliver high-quality products. · Key Responsibilities · Lead, mentor, an ...


  • Hollywoodbets Johannesburg

    The Star Factory Seeks Software Development Instructor · We are looking for a skilled Software Development Instructor to join our team in Johannesburg, Gauteng. This role involves educating individuals and teams on software development principles and practices. · Responsibilities ...


  • IOCO Johannesburg

    Senior Software Developer · We are seeking a highly skilled Senior Software Developer to join our IT team. The ideal candidate will be responsible for developing and maintaining our .NET Web Forms application and C# services, ensuring the reliability and performance of our system ...


  • Datafin IT Recruitment Johannesburg

    About Us · DataFin was founded in 1999 and has established relationships with industry leaders, with a vast majority of its business being repeat business. · We are seeking an ambitious Junior Software Developer to join our team in Joburg. Your core role will involve participatin ...


  • Curiska Johannesburg

    About the Company · We specialize in creating custom CRM solutions using Microsoft technologies. · Our team is looking for a graduate software developer to join us and gain valuable experience in developing full-stack CRM applications using both front-end and back-end development ...


  • Norrin Radd (Pty) ltd Johannesburg

    Software Developer Lead · The ideal candidate will have a strong technical background and leadership skills to guide the team. · Minimum Requirements: · A Bachelor's degree in Computer Science, Software Engineering, or Information Technology. · 5-10 years of professional work exp ...


  • Hollywoodbets Johannesburg

    Empower the Next Generation of Developers · We are seeking a passionate Software Development Instructor to design and deliver dynamic training programs, equipping individuals and teams with essential coding languages, methodologies, and best practices. · The ideal candidate will ...


  • Preferental Technologies (Pty) Ltd. Johannesburg

    About Preferental · We are a trailblazer in the digital property management sector, dedicated to pioneering customer-focused solutions. Our vision is to establish new standards in customer service and contribute to societal betterment. · We nurture a culture of continuous learnin ...


  • E&D Recruiters Johannesburg

    Job Title: Software Developer (Computer Science) · Minimum Requirements and Experience: · Bachelor's Degree in Computer Science. · 0-2 years of experience in software development, web development, Linux, database management, cloud technologies, and mobile development. · Proficien ...


  • Pronel Personnel Johannesburg

    Senior Software Developer · We are seeking a highly professional Senior Software Developer to join our team at our company. · The ideal candidate will be responsible for designing, developing, and maintaining high-quality software applications that meet the needs of our clients i ...


  • Standard Bank of South Africa Limited Johannesburg

    Job Title: Software Developer · We are seeking a skilled Software Developer to join our team in Personal & Private Banking. · The ideal candidate will design, code, test, debug, and maintain programs in development environments, adhering to strict programming standards under the ...


  • Pronel Personnel Johannesburg

    We are seeking a highly professional Senior Software Developer to join our client based in Johannesburg. · The successful candidate will be responsible for designing, developing, and maintaining the company's insurance management software solutions. · Requirements: · A Grade 12 ( ...

Jobs
>
Johannesburg
>
Software developer